Book Review: Rampant


TITLE: Rampant
PART IN SERIES: Book 1 of the Killer Unicorns series
AUTHOR: Diane Peterfreund
PUBLISHED: 2009
GENRE: Young adult, series, fantasy
PREMISE: Astrid has always scoffed at her mother's tales of killer unicorns. But then she and her boyfriend get attacked and discovers that they are in fact very real and she is a descendant of a long line of unicorn hunters.
MY REVIEW: I will be honest: I utterly adored this book so there is probably going to be heavy bias in this review. I will say, it's not perfect. Sometimes I was a bit confused about things. But the awesomeness far outwieghs the few flaws. For one: a unique idea! A author who wasn't afraid to take much loved childhood figures such as unicorns and turn them into scary monsters. That takes guts and I love it when authors aren't afraid to do an idea that may turn off readers.
Then there's the fact that she has strong heroines in this. Phil is my favorite for those wondering. Also, bravo to Peterfreund for having a guy in there who said no to sex. Yes, girls there are respectable guys out there like this. These are the ones you want to hang on to. But she also didn't try and make Giovanni perfect either because he has flaws. Plus, the romance was not the only thing driving the book! Finally, a current YA novel where the girl isn't torn between two guys and her main issue is who to choose! Yay!
So, in other words, I highly reccomend this, particularly to my fellow Tamora Pierce fans. You will love it, gaurenteed. Another favorite of 2009.
WHO SHOULD READ: Tamora Pierce fans, fans of Graceling, fantasy fans, you like strong willed heroines
MY RATING: Four and a half out of Five unicorn horns
